TREDINNICK, J., May 20, 1971.

In this equity action, plaintiff, Raymond Pearlstine, Esq. (Pearlstine), seeks specific performance of an oral contract for the purchase of 50 shares of Chatham Broadcasting Company, Inc. (Chatham), capital stock from defendant, Clyde R. Fry (Fry). Defendant Fry filed an answer, new matter and counterclaim demanding that Pearlstine deliver the share certificates owned by Fry to him.
